Harnessing Precious Metals for Retirement: The Gold IRA Path
Securing a comfortable retirement requires careful planning and strategic investment decisions. As traditional retirement accounts encounter uncertainties in the market, many individuals are shifting to alternative asset classes like precious metals. A Gold IRA, or Individual Retirement Account, offers a compelling opportunity for investors seeking to protect their portfolios and potentially enhance long-term returns.
These accounts allow you to allocate in physical gold, silver, platinum, or palladium inside a tax-advantaged retirement framework. Unlike traditional IRAs which primarily invest in stocks and bonds, a Gold IRA provides exposure to a tangible asset that has historically acted as a reserve of value during times of economic turmoil.
A Gold IRA can be an valuable addition to your overall retirement strategy, presenting potential advantages such as:
* **Inflation Hedge:** Precious metals often increase in value during periods of inflation, potentially safeguarding the purchasing power of your retirement savings.
* **Portfolio Diversification:** Incorporating gold to your portfolio can mitigate overall risk by providing a link that is typically uncorrelated with traditional assets.
* **Tax Advantages:** Similar to other IRAs, contributions to a Gold IRA may be eligible for tax deductions, and earnings grow without immediate taxation.
Before investing in a Gold IRA, it's important to perform thorough research, understand the connected fees and regulations, and seek advice from a qualified financial advisor.
